Biography

I utilize a variety of approaches, including, but not limited to: Neurodiversity-Affirming, Gender-Identity Affirming, Person-Centered, Strengths-Based, Decolonizing, Positive Psychology, and Trauma-Informed. I primarily use CBT and Motivational Interviewing techniques.

I believe that mutual trust and respect take time to develop, providing the foundation for a successful therapeutic relationship. You are the expert of your own life. I am not here to tell you who to become. I am here to provide you with the necessary tools to guide and support you on your own path.

I believe that knowledge is power. I recognize the role intersectionality plays in affecting our lives on a personal, environmental, and community level, particularly BIPOC, Disabled, Autistic, ADHD, and LGBTQIA2S+ communities. I want to empower you to recognize your own strengths, enabling you to define yourself rather than let others define you.
